How Zero-Knowledge Proofs Enable Private Credentials on Blockchain

Blockchain technology has revolutionized the way we think about digital transactions, decentralization, and data security. However, its inherent transparency can pose significant privacy challenges, especially when sensitive information is involved. Zero-Knowledge Proofs (ZKPs) have emerged as a powerful cryptographic tool to address these concerns by enabling private credentials on-chain without compromising security or integrity.

Understanding Zero-Knowledge Proofs

Zero-Knowledge Proofs are cryptographic protocols that allow one party—the prover—to convince another—the verifier—that a specific statement is true without revealing any additional information beyond the validity of that statement. This means users can prove ownership or authenticity without exposing underlying data such as personal details or transaction amounts.

The core properties of ZKPs include:

  • Soundness: Ensures that false statements cannot be convincingly proven.
  • Completeness: Valid statements can always be proven if they are true.
  • Zero-Knowledge: The verifier gains no knowledge about the actual data behind the proof.

These properties make ZKPs particularly suitable for privacy-preserving applications in blockchain environments where transparency often conflicts with confidentiality needs.

The Role of ZKPs in Blockchain Privacy

Traditional blockchain networks like Bitcoin and Ethereum operate transparently; every transaction is publicly recorded and accessible to anyone. While this promotes trustlessness and auditability, it also exposes sensitive user data—such as identities, transaction amounts, or asset holdings—which may not be desirable for all use cases.

Zero-Knowledge Proofs offer a solution by allowing users to perform transactions and demonstrate ownership or compliance with certain rules without revealing their identities or transaction specifics. This capability transforms how privacy is managed on-chain:

  • Users can execute private transactions that hide sender details and amounts while still being verifiable.
  • Identity verification processes become more secure since proofs confirm attributes (e.g., age over 18) without disclosing personal information.
  • Smart contracts can enforce conditions based on private data inputs verified through ZKPs rather than exposing raw data.

This approach enhances user privacy while maintaining the trustless nature of blockchain systems.

How ZKPs Facilitate Private Credentials On-Chain

Private credentials refer to proofs of ownership or rights over assets, identities, or permissions that do not reveal sensitive details during validation. Zero-Knowledge Proofs enable this functionality through several mechanisms:

1. Private Transactions

Using ZKPs like zk-SNARKs (Succinct Non-interactive Arguments of Knowledge), users can submit proof that they possess sufficient funds for a transfer without revealing their account balance or identity. These proofs are succinct enough to be verified quickly within smart contracts, ensuring efficiency alongside privacy.

2. Confidential Asset Ownership

With zero-knowledge techniques, individuals can demonstrate ownership of specific tokens or assets—such as NFTs—without disclosing detailed metadata associated with those assets. This preserves confidentiality while confirming possession during exchanges or transfers.

3. Privacy-Preserving Identity Verification

In identity-focused applications like KYC (Know Your Customer), users generate zero-knowledge proofs attesting they meet certain criteria (e.g., age threshold) without sharing personal documents directly with service providers—a process crucial for compliant yet private onboarding procedures.

4. Secure Smart Contracts

Smart contracts integrated with ZKP capabilities verify complex conditions based on encrypted inputs rather than raw data disclosures—enabling functionalities such as confidential voting systems where individual votes remain hidden but overall results are transparent and trustworthy.

5. Decentralized Finance Applications

In DeFi platforms aiming for user anonymity alongside financial integrity, zero-knowledge protocols facilitate anonymous lending/borrowing operations while ensuring collateralization ratios are maintained correctly through verifiable proofs rather than exposed account balances.

Recent Innovations in Zero-Knowledge Technology

The field has seen rapid advancements aimed at improving efficiency and scalability:

  • SNARKs: These provide highly compact proofs suitable for large-scale deployment due to their small size and fast verification times.

  • zk-STARKs: An alternative offering transparent setup processes with increased resistance against quantum attacks; zk-STARKs also boast faster proof generation times compared to earlier SNARK implementations.

These innovations have been integrated into major blockchain projects such as Ethereum’s Layer 2 solutions — including zk-rollups — which bundle multiple transactions into a single proof submitted on-chain efficiently reducing costs while preserving privacy.

Industry Adoption & Practical Implementations

Several projects exemplify how zero-knowledge technology enables private credentials:

ProjectFocus AreaKey Features
Aztec NetworkPrivate TransactionsEnables confidential transfers within Ethereum using zk-SNARKS
Tornado CashTransaction PrivacyMixes ETH deposits anonymously via zero knowledge protocols
Matter Labs’ zkSyncScalable Payments & Smart ContractsCombines scalability with privacy features using zk-rollups

Ethereum’s ongoing research into integrating ZKP-based solutions aims at making decentralized applications more secure by default regarding user confidentiality.

Challenges Facing Widespread Adoption

Despite promising developments, several hurdles remain before widespread adoption becomes mainstream:

Security Concerns

Implementing robust zero-knowledge protocols requires meticulous design; vulnerabilities could compromise entire systems if not properly validated during development phases.

Scalability Limitations

While recent algorithms improve performance significantly compared to earlier versions, high computational overhead still poses challenges—especially in high-frequency transactional environments requiring real-time processing capabilities.

Regulatory Environment

As regulators scrutinize privacy-enhancing technologies more closely—for instance under anti-money laundering laws—they may impose restrictions impacting how privately transacted assets are used across jurisdictions worldwide.

Future Outlook: Balancing Privacy With Compliance

The evolution of zero-knowledge proof technology suggests an increasingly sophisticated landscape where enhanced user privacy coexists alongside regulatory compliance frameworks designed to prevent misuse such as illicit activities—all within decentralized ecosystems striving for transparency when necessary but respecting individual rights otherwise.

Advances in protocol standardization will likely facilitate interoperability across different blockchains—a critical step toward seamless integration into existing financial infrastructure—and foster broader industry acceptance driven by both technological maturity and regulatory clarity.


By enabling private credentials directly on-chain through advanced cryptography like ZKPs, blockchain platforms unlock new possibilities—from confidential finance operations to secure identity management—all while maintaining decentralization principles rooted in trustless verification methods. As research progresses and implementation barriers diminish over time, expect these tools to become integral components shaping the future landscape of digital asset security and user sovereignty online.

What Privacy Tools Can Users Employ on Ethereum?

Ethereum’s rise as a leading blockchain platform has revolutionized decentralized finance (DeFi), non-fungible tokens (NFTs), and smart contract applications. However, its inherent transparency—where every transaction is publicly recorded—poses significant privacy challenges for users. As adoption grows, so does the need for effective privacy tools that enable users to protect their financial data and personal information without compromising security or network integrity. This article explores the key privacy solutions available on Ethereum, recent technological advancements, and how they impact user security and regulatory considerations.

Understanding Ethereum’s Transparency and Privacy Challenges

Ethereum operates as a decentralized ledger where all transactions are visible to anyone with access to the blockchain explorer. While this transparency ensures trustlessness and immutability, it also means that transaction details such as sender addresses, recipient addresses, amounts transferred, and timestamps are accessible publicly. For individual users or institutions handling sensitive data or large transactions, this openness can be a deterrent due to concerns over privacy breaches or targeted attacks.

The tension between transparency and privacy has prompted developers to create specialized tools aimed at masking transaction details while maintaining the network's security features. These solutions aim not only to enhance user confidentiality but also to comply with evolving regulatory standards around financial data protection.

Zero-Knowledge Proofs: The Backbone of Privacy on Ethereum

One of the most promising cryptographic innovations in enhancing Ethereum privacy is Zero-Knowledge Proofs (ZKPs). ZKPs allow one party—the prover—to demonstrate knowledge of certain information without revealing the actual data itself. This technology enables private verification processes that do not compromise underlying details.

Recent developments from companies like zkSync by Matter Labs and StarkWare have advanced ZKP implementations tailored for Ethereum's ecosystem. These platforms facilitate private transactions where users can prove ownership or validity without exposing sensitive information such as wallet balances or transaction specifics.

Key benefits include:

  • Confidentiality of transaction amounts
  • Anonymity of sender/recipient addresses
  • Reduced on-chain data footprint

By integrating ZKPs into layer 2 scaling solutions like zkSync and Optimism, developers have significantly improved both scalability and privacy simultaneously—a critical step toward mainstream adoption.

Private Transactions Through Cryptographic Techniques

Beyond ZKPs, other cryptographic methods underpin private transactions on Ethereum:

  • Tornado Cash: A widely used mixer service that employs zero-knowledge proofs to obfuscate transaction trails by pooling multiple deposits before withdrawal—making it difficult for observers to trace funds back to specific sources.

  • Aztec Network: An innovative protocol offering confidential transfers within DeFi applications using advanced cryptography techniques like bulletproofs—a form of succinct zero-knowledge proof—to conceal transfer details while ensuring correctness.

These tools serve different use cases—from simple fund mixing for individual privacy needs to complex confidential DeFi operations—highlighting how cryptography underpins modern efforts toward transactional anonymity.

Layer 2 Solutions Enhancing Privacy

Layer 2 scaling solutions such as Optimism and Polygon aim primarily at increasing throughput but increasingly incorporate features supporting user privacy:

  • Optimism: Recently integrated ZKP technology into its layer 2 framework in March 2024; this allows private transactions processed off-chain before being settled securely on mainnet.

  • Polygon: Offers various sidechains with optional encryption features designed for enterprise-grade confidentiality in DeFi operations.

Layer 2 solutions reduce congestion fees while enabling more flexible implementation of private protocols—making them attractive options for both individual users seeking anonymity—and enterprises requiring compliance with strict confidentiality standards.

Recent Developments in Ethereum Privacy Technologies

The landscape is rapidly evolving with notable updates:

  1. In April 2023, zkSync partnered with StarkWare—a leader in scalable zero-knowledge proofs—to integrate their respective technologies seamlessly into existing networks.

  2. Tornado Cash released an update in January 2024 improving mixing capabilities further; these enhancements make tracing more difficult even against sophisticated analysis techniques.

  3. Optimism announced successful integration of advanced ZKP protocols into its layer 2 environment during March 2024 — marking a significant milestone toward widespread adoption of confidential transactions within scalable infrastructure frameworks.

These developments reflect ongoing efforts by industry leaders aiming at balancing usability with robust security guarantees necessary for broader acceptance across sectors including finance, healthcare, supply chain management—and potentially regulatory environments demanding compliance measures aligned with anti-money laundering (AML) standards.

Regulatory Considerations & Security Risks

While these innovative tools bolster user sovereignty over personal data—and support compliance initiatives—they also attract scrutiny from regulators concerned about illicit activities facilitated through anonymous channels:

Regulatory Scrutiny

Governments worldwide are increasingly examining how privacy-enhancing technologies could be exploited for money laundering or tax evasion purposes. Platforms like Tornado Cash faced bans in some jurisdictions due to misuse allegations despite their legitimate uses within legal boundaries; similar concerns apply broadly across crypto ecosystems employing strong anonymization techniques.

Security Risks

Cryptography-based systems inherently carry risks if improperly implemented:

  • Vulnerabilities may emerge through bugs or design flaws
  • Sophisticated attackers might exploit weaknesses leading to loss of funds

Ensuring rigorous audits alongside continuous updates remains essential when deploying these complex systems at scale.

Impact on Market Dynamics

As more participants adopt enhanced privacy measures:

  • DeFi protocols may see shifts towards more confidential lending/borrowing models,
  • Asset flows could become less transparent,
  • Competition might intensify among platforms offering superior anonymity features,

which could reshape market strategies around trustless interactions versus user confidentiality needs.

Embracing Privacy While Navigating Challenges

Ethereum’s suite of emerging privacy tools demonstrates a clear trajectory toward balancing decentralization’s transparency benefits against individual rights’ demands for confidentiality. Zero-Knowledge Proofs stand out as foundational technology enabling secure yet private interactions—not only protecting user identities but also fostering broader trustworthiness essential for institutional adoption.

However, stakeholders must remain vigilant regarding regulatory landscapes' evolution—including potential restrictions—and prioritize security best practices when deploying cryptographic solutions at scale.

Final Thoughts: The Future Pathway Toward Private Blockchain Interactions

As blockchain innovation accelerates—with ongoing improvements in scalability via Layer 2 integrations—the focus increasingly shifts toward making these networks both fast AND private by design rather than afterthoughts alone. Developers continue refining cryptographic techniques like ZKPs alongside practical implementations such as mixers (e.g., Tornado Cash) and confidential DeFi protocols (e.g., Aztec).

For everyday users interested in safeguarding their financial activities without sacrificing decentralization principles—or risking exposure—they now have access through multiple layers—from simple mixers up through sophisticated zero-knowledge-based systems—that cater specifically to varying levels of technical expertise yet uphold core principles rooted in trustlessness & censorship resistance.

What Is Wrapped Bitcoin (WBTC)?

Wrapped Bitcoin (WBTC) is a digital asset that combines the stability and value of Bitcoin (BTC) with the flexibility and programmability of Ethereum’s blockchain. Essentially, WBTC is an ERC-20 token on Ethereum that maintains a 1:1 peg with Bitcoin, meaning each WBTC token is backed by one actual BTC held in reserve. This setup allows users to leverage their Bitcoin holdings within the Ethereum ecosystem, unlocking new opportunities for decentralized finance (DeFi), non-fungible tokens (NFTs), and other smart contract applications.

How Does Wrapped Bitcoin Work?

The process of creating WBTC involves "wrapping" BTC through a smart contract on the Ethereum network. When a user deposits BTC into a custodian or merchant responsible for managing these assets, an equivalent amount of WBTC tokens are minted on Ethereum and credited to the user’s wallet. Conversely, when someone wants to redeem their WBTC for actual BTC, they can burn their tokens in exchange for withdrawal from the custodial reserve.

This mechanism ensures transparency and trustworthiness because each minted WBTC is fully backed by an equivalent amount of real BTC stored securely off-chain. The entire process relies heavily on trusted custodians and decentralized governance structures to maintain integrity.

Why Was Wrapped Bitcoin Created?

Bitcoin operates independently on its own blockchain—known as proof-of-work—making it incompatible with many other platforms like Ethereum that support smart contracts. This incompatibility limits how Bitcoin can be used beyond simple holding or trading.

Wrapped tokens like WBTC emerged as solutions to this interoperability challenge. They enable users to utilize their Bitcoins within DeFi protocols such as lending platforms, liquidity pools, or NFT marketplaces without selling or transferring their original assets directly on the Bitcoin network. By bridging these two ecosystems, wrapped tokens expand liquidity options while maintaining exposure to Bitcoin's price movements.

Key Features of Wrapped Bitcoin

  • Pegged 1:1 with BTC: Each WBTC token corresponds directly to one bitcoin held in reserve.
  • ERC-20 Compatibility: As an ERC-20 token standardized on Ethereum, it integrates seamlessly into existing DeFi protocols.
  • Decentralized Governance: Managed by organizations like the WBTC DAO which oversee issuance policies and security standards.
  • Transparency & Security: Regular audits ensure reserves match circulating supply; security measures protect against potential vulnerabilities.

Use Cases for Wrapped Bitcoin

WBTC has become integral in various sectors within crypto:

Decentralized Finance (DeFi)

Users can lend or borrow against their holdings via platforms such as Aave or Compound using WBTC as collateral. It also facilitates trading through decentralized exchanges like Uniswap or SushiSwap due to its high liquidity profile.

Liquidity Provision & Trading

As one of the most traded wrapped assets tied directly to BTC’s value, WBTC provides essential liquidity pools that help facilitate smooth trading across multiple DeFi platforms without needing direct access to traditional exchanges.

NFTs & Asset Tokenization

Some projects use wrapped assets like WBTC as representations of physical items—such as art pieces or real estate—allowing fractional ownership and easier transferability across blockchain networks.

Recent Trends & Developments

Over recent years, several key developments have shaped how wrapped tokens function:

Market Adoption Growth

During 2020–2021's DeFi boom, demand for wrapped assets surged significantly; protocols integrated more tightly with services supporting collateralization and trading involving WBTC. The total value locked (TVL) in these protocols reflected this increased adoption—a testament to its utility among investors seeking exposure combined with functional versatility.

Regulatory Environment Changes

Regulators worldwide began scrutinizing wrapped tokens around 2022–2023 due partly to concerns over securities classification and compliance issues. In particular, U.S.-based agencies such as SEC issued guidelines clarifying how certain derivatives might be regulated under existing securities laws—a move that could influence future operations involving wrapping mechanisms globally.

Security Enhancements & Challenges

Despite widespread adoption benefits, security remains paramount given past incidents where vulnerabilities led to hacks targeting related protocols in 2021–2022. These events prompted industry-wide efforts toward improving audit processes—including multi-signature wallets—and implementing stricter verification procedures during minting/burning operations.

Technological Innovations

Advances such as cross-chain bridges have expanded interoperability beyond just ETH-Bitcoin pairing—for example enabling seamless transfers between Binance Smart Chain or Polygon networks—thus broadening use cases further while reducing transaction costs associated with wrapping/unwrapping processes.

Risks Facing Wrapped Tokens Like WBTc

While offering significant advantages — including increased liquidity access — there are inherent risks involved:

Regulatory Uncertainty

As authorities develop clearer frameworks around digital assets—including stablecoins—the legal status surrounding wrapped tokens remains fluid; future regulations could impose restrictions impacting usability or even lead some jurisdictions outright banning certain types of wrapping activities.

Security Vulnerabilities

Smart contract bugs remain a concern; if exploited successfully during minting/burning processes—or if custodial reserves are compromised—the entire system's integrity could be jeopardized leading potentially loss of funds trust erosion among users.

Market Volatility Impact

Since each token’s value closely tracks bitcoin prices—which are known for volatility—sharp price swings may cause rapid fluctuations in perceived worth within DeFi applications affecting investor confidence.

Technological Challenges

Cross-chain interactions require complex infrastructure; any failure at protocol levels might disrupt transactions leading either delays or losses especially during unwrapping phases where timely redemption is critical.


By understanding what Wrapped Bitcoin offers—from its core functionality rooted in interoperability—to ongoing developments shaping its future stakeholders can better navigate this evolving landscape effectively balancing opportunity against risk.

Understanding Future Outlook For Wrapping Technologies

Looking ahead at innovations like improved cross-chain bridges coupled with increasing regulatory clarity suggests potential growth avenues but also underscores need for robust security practices.. As more institutions recognize digital assets’ role within broader financial systems—with regulators providing clearer guidance—the adoption rate may accelerate further while emphasizing transparency standards necessary for long-term sustainability.

How To Safely Use Wrappd Assets Like WBTC

For investors interested in utilizing WBTC safely:

  • Always verify your sources when acquiring new tokens.
  • Use reputable wallets compatible with ERC-20 standards.
  • Keep abreast of regulatory updates relevant locally.
  • Consider diversifying holdings across different asset classes.

By doing so you align your investment strategies toward both growth potential and risk mitigation amid ongoing market evolution.


In summary ,Wrapped Bitcoin exemplifies innovative solutions aimed at bridging separate blockchain worlds — expanding utility while maintaining core asset values—and continues evolving amidst technological advancements alongside regulatory considerations shaping its trajectory forward

Limitations of Using Directional Indicators in Range-Bound Markets

Understanding the strengths and weaknesses of technical analysis tools is essential for traders aiming to navigate different market conditions effectively. Among these tools, directional indicators such as the Average Directional Index (ADX), Directional Movement Index (DMI), and related components like +DI and -DI are widely used to identify trend strength and direction. However, their effectiveness diminishes significantly in range-bound markets—periods when prices move sideways within a narrow trading range without establishing a clear upward or downward trend.

What Are Directional Indicators?

Directional indicators are designed to help traders determine whether a market is trending or consolidating. They analyze price movements over time to generate signals that suggest potential entry or exit points. The ADX, for example, measures the overall strength of a trend regardless of its direction, while +DI and -DI indicate bullish or bearish tendencies respectively.

These tools are popular because they provide quantifiable data that can be integrated into trading strategies across various asset classes—including stocks, forex, commodities, and cryptocurrencies. When markets exhibit strong trends, these indicators can confirm momentum shifts; however, their reliability wanes when markets lack clear directional movement.

Why Do These Indicators Struggle in Range-Bound Markets?

Range-bound markets—also known as sideways or consolidation phases—are characterized by prices oscillating within defined support and resistance levels without establishing sustained trends. During such periods:

  • Price fluctuations tend to be less decisive.
  • Volatility may increase due to frequent reversals.
  • Trends become ambiguous or nonexistent.

In this environment, directional indicators often produce misleading signals because they interpret minor price swings as potential trend changes rather than noise within a consolidation phase. This leads to several issues:

False Signals

Directional indicators can generate numerous false positives during sideways movements. For instance, an oversold condition indicated by ADX might prompt traders to buy expecting an upward breakout; however, the market could simply continue oscillating within its range before any real breakout occurs.

Overreliance on Trend Strength

Since many directional tools focus on identifying strong trends rather than consolidations themselves, they may signal "trend" conditions where none exist—a phenomenon known as "whipsaw." This results in entering trades prematurely or holding onto positions longer than advisable based on unreliable signals.

Difficulty Timing Trades

In non-trending environments with frequent reversals and volatility spikes, timing entries and exits becomes more challenging using traditional directional indicators alone. Traders risk being caught in choppy price action that erodes profits through multiple false signals.

Recent Developments Addressing These Limitations

Recognizing these limitations has prompted traders and analysts to explore alternative approaches:

  • Use of Complementary Indicators: Moving averages (such as the 20-period simple moving average) combined with Bollinger Bands can better identify periods of low volatility typical of range-bound markets.

  • Adaptive Strategies: Some traders employ multi-timeframe analysis—checking shorter-term charts for entry points while confirming broader ranges on longer-term charts—to improve decision-making accuracy.

  • Market Context Awareness: Incorporating fundamental analysis alongside technical signals helps avoid overreacting solely based on indicator readings during uncertain phases like consolidations.

Additionally, recent research emphasizes developing adaptive algorithms that adjust parameters dynamically based on current market conditions rather than relying solely on static indicator settings.

Risks Associated With Relying Solely on Directional Indicators

Overdependence on these tools during sideways markets can lead to significant pitfalls:

  1. Eroded Trader Confidence: Repeated false signals diminish trust in technical analysis methods.
  2. Financial Losses: Misinterpreted signals may prompt premature entries/exits resulting in losses.
  3. Market Misinterpretation: Traders might mistake consolidation phases for emerging trends if not cautious enough with indicator readings.

To mitigate these risks:

  • Diversify strategies by combining multiple technical tools.
  • Use risk management techniques such as stop-loss orders diligently.
  • Maintain awareness of broader market fundamentals influencing asset prices beyond chart patterns alone.

Practical Tips for Navigating Range-Bound Markets

Given the limitations discussed above,

  1. Focus more on support/resistance levels rather than trend-based indicators alone.
  2. Employ oscillators like RSI (Relative Strength Index) or Stochastic Oscillator which tend to perform better during consolidations by signaling overbought/oversold conditions.
  3. Consider employing non-trend-following strategies such as mean reversion approaches when appropriate.
  4. Always confirm signals from multiple sources before executing trades—this enhances reliability amid uncertain environments.

By understanding both the capabilities and constraints of directional indicators within different market contexts—including range-bound scenarios—traders can make more informed decisions aligned with prevailing conditions instead of relying blindly on single-tool analyses.. Recognizing when traditional trend-following metrics fall short encourages diversification into other analytical methods that improve overall trading robustness amidst volatile or indecisive markets.

Why is Volume Confirmation Critical for Pattern Validity in Crypto Trading?

In the fast-paced world of cryptocurrency trading, understanding market signals is essential for making informed decisions. Among these signals, chart patterns such as head and shoulders, triangles, or double bottoms are widely used by traders to predict future price movements. However, not all patterns are equally reliable on their own. This is where volume confirmation plays a vital role—adding a layer of validation that can significantly improve the accuracy of pattern-based predictions.

What Is Volume Confirmation in Cryptocurrency Trading?

Volume confirmation involves analyzing trading volume alongside price movements to verify the legitimacy of technical patterns. When a pattern forms on a chart—say, an ascending triangle—the accompanying trading volume provides insight into whether this pattern reflects genuine market interest or if it’s potentially misleading. High trading volume during the formation or breakout of a pattern suggests strong participation and conviction among traders, increasing confidence that the trend will continue in the predicted direction.

Conversely, low volume may indicate lack of interest or even manipulation—such as wash trading or fakeouts—that can produce false signals. Therefore, integrating volume data helps traders distinguish between authentic trends and deceptive moves driven by short-term speculation or market manipulation.

The Role of Volume Confirmation in Technical Analysis

Technical analysis relies heavily on identifying consistent patterns within historical price data to forecast future movements. However, without considering trade activity levels (volume), these patterns can sometimes be unreliable indicators due to false breakouts or reversals.

Volume acts as an additional filter: when combined with chart formations like flags or pennants, it confirms whether buyers and sellers genuinely support the move. For example:

  • Bullish Signals: A breakout from resistance accompanied by high volume indicates strong buying interest.
  • Bearish Signals: A breakdown below support with increased selling activity suggests genuine downward momentum.

This synergy between price action and trade activity enhances decision-making accuracy and reduces exposure to false positives—a common pitfall in crypto markets characterized by rapid swings and speculative behavior.

Key Benefits of Using Volume Confirmation

1. Validating Market Sentiment

High volumes during upward moves reflect robust buying pressure; similarly, elevated selling volumes during declines signal strong bearish sentiment. Recognizing these cues helps traders gauge overall market mood more precisely than relying solely on price charts.

2. Improving Pattern Reliability

Patterns confirmed with significant trade volumes tend to be more trustworthy than those formed on thin liquidity conditions. For instance:

  • An ascending triangle with rising volume before breakout indicates genuine accumulation.
  • Conversely, if breakout occurs on low volume amid sideways movement, caution is warranted as it might be a false signal.

3. Enhancing Risk Management Strategies

By observing how volumes behave around key levels (support/resistance), traders can better assess entry points and set stop-loss orders accordingly—reducing potential losses from sudden reversals caused by manipulated trades or fakeouts prevalent in unregulated crypto markets.

4. Detecting Market Manipulation

Large players (whales) often attempt to manipulate prices through coordinated trades that generate artificial spikes in volume without real underlying demand—a tactic known as "pump-and-dump." Recognizing discrepancies between price action and abnormal surges in traded volumes allows experienced traders to avoid falling victim to such schemes.

Recent Trends Impacting Volume Confirmation Practices

The last few years have seen notable developments affecting how traders utilize volume confirmation:

  • Market Volatility: The rise of DeFi projects and NFTs has increased overall trading activity but also introduced higher volatility levels—making careful analysis crucial.

  • Regulatory Changes: Authorities like the U.S SEC have issued guidelines impacting transparency standards across exchanges; this influences how accurately traded volumes reflect true market interest.

  • Technological Advancements: Modern platforms now offer real-time analytics powered by AI algorithms capable of detecting suspicious activities related to abnormal trade volumes.

  • Community Insights: Social media buzz often correlates with spikes in trading activity; monitoring community sentiment alongside technical signals adds depth for validating patterns through social listening tools integrated into many platforms today.

Risks Associated With Relying Solely on Volume Data

While incorporating volume confirmation improves prediction reliability significantly, over-reliance carries risks:

  • False Signals Due To Manipulation: Large-volume trades orchestrated by whales can create misleading impressions about true supply/demand dynamics.

  • Market Noise During High Volatility Periods: Rapid swings may distort typical relationships between price movement and traded volumes.

  • Limited Contextual Information: Sole focus on one indicator ignores other critical factors like macroeconomic news events influencing trader behavior globally.

To mitigate these risks effectively:

  • Use multiple indicators (e.g., RSI , Bollinger Bands) alongside volume data
  • Confirm signals across different timeframes
  • Stay updated about regulatory changes affecting exchange transparency

Educational resources—including webinars & courses—are increasingly available for traders seeking mastery over combining various analytical tools responsibly.

How Traders Can Effectively Use Volume Confirmation Today

For optimal results:

  1. Look for confluence — situations where multiple indicators align—for example:

    • Price breaking resistance with increasing high-volume candles
    • Divergence where declining prices occur despite rising volumes indicating potential exhaustion
  2. Pay attention during volatile periods: heightened caution ensures you don’t misinterpret fakeouts caused by manipulative tactics

3.. Incorporate community insights: social media trends often precede large moves; combining this qualitative data with quantitative analysis enhances decision-making

4.. Regularly review recent market trends: understanding broader shifts helps contextualize individual pattern validity


In summary, integrating volume confirmation into your crypto trading strategy isn’t just advisable—it’s essential for validating chart patterns' authenticity amidst unpredictable markets filled with noise & manipulation risks . By paying close attention not only to what prices are doing but also how actively they’re being traded at each step along the way , you position yourself better against false signals while gaining deeper insights into genuine shifts within dynamic digital asset markets .

How Do Credit Spreads Compare to Other Investment Strategies?

Understanding the role of credit spreads in investment decision-making is essential for investors seeking to optimize their portfolios. While credit spreads are a key indicator within fixed-income markets, they are often compared with other strategies such as equity investing, diversification techniques, and alternative assets. This article explores how credit spread-based strategies stack up against other approaches, providing clarity on their advantages and limitations.

What Are Credit Spread Strategies?

Credit spread strategies involve analyzing the difference in yields between bonds of similar credit quality but different maturities or risk profiles. Investors leverage this information to identify opportunities for higher returns or risk mitigation. For example, buying high-yield bonds when spreads are wide can offer attractive income potential if market conditions improve. Conversely, narrowing spreads might signal a safer environment suitable for more conservative investments.

These strategies are rooted in market sentiment and economic outlooks; widening spreads often indicate increased default risk or economic downturns, while narrowing spreads suggest confidence and stability. As such, credit spread analysis provides real-time insights into market health that can inform tactical investment decisions.

Comparing Credit Spreads with Equity Investment Strategies

Equity investing focuses on purchasing shares of companies with growth potential or dividend income. Unlike fixed-income securities where returns depend largely on interest rates and credit risk perceptions (reflected through credit spreads), equities are driven by company performance, earnings growth, and broader economic factors.

While both approaches aim for capital appreciation or income generation:

  • Risk Profile: Equities tend to be more volatile than bonds; however, they also offer higher return potential over the long term.
  • Market Sensitivity: Equity prices react sharply to corporate news and macroeconomic shifts; bond markets respond primarily through changes in interest rates and credit conditions.
  • Diversification Benefits: Combining equities with fixed-income instruments like bonds can reduce overall portfolio volatility—credit spreads help gauge when bond markets may be more attractive relative to stocks.

In essence, while equity strategies focus on company fundamentals and growth prospects, credit spread-based bond strategies provide insight into macroeconomic risks that influence debt markets.

How Do Credit Spread Strategies Compare With Diversification Techniques?

Diversification is a fundamental principle across all investment styles—spreading investments across asset classes reduces exposure to any single source of risk. Using credit spreads as part of a diversification strategy involves adjusting bond holdings based on perceived risks indicated by spread movements.

For example:

  • When credit spreads widen significantly due to economic uncertainty or rising default fears, an investor might reduce exposure to high-yield bonds.
  • Conversely, narrowing spreads could signal an opportunity to increase allocations toward corporate debt for better yield prospects without taking excessive additional risk.

Compared with broad diversification across stocks and commodities alone,

  • Credit Spread Analysis Offers Tactical Edge: It allows investors to fine-tune their fixed-income allocations based on current market signals.
  • Limitations: Relying solely on spread movements without considering other factors like macroeconomic data may lead to misjudgments during volatile periods when signals become noisy.

Thus, integrating credit spread analysis enhances traditional diversification by adding a layer of tactical insight specific to bond markets' dynamics.

Comparing Credit Spreads With Alternative Asset Classes

Alternative investments include real estate (REITs), commodities (gold), hedge funds, private equity—and increasingly cryptocurrencies. These assets often serve as hedges against inflation or sources of uncorrelated returns but come with distinct risks compared to traditional bonds influenced by credit spreads.

For instance:

  • Cryptocurrencies have shown high volatility unrelated directly to traditional financial indicators like interest rates or default risks reflected in bond yields.
  • Real estate investments tend not directly tied but can be affected indirectly through broader economic conditions impacting borrowing costs signaled via widening or narrowing credits spreds.

Investors comparing these options should consider:

  1. The liquidity profile
  2. Risk-return characteristics
  3. Correlation patterns during different economic cycles

While alternative assets diversify away from fixed-income risks indicated by changing credits spreds—they do not replace the predictive power that analyzing these spreds offers regarding macroeconomic health.

Strengths & Limitations of Using Credit Spreads Compared To Other Strategies

Credit-spread-based investing provides valuable insights into market sentiment about default risk which is crucial during periods of economic stress—such as recessions—or rapid rate hikes by central banks[1]. Its strength lies in its abilityto act as an early warning system for deteriorating financial conditions before they fully materialize in stock prices or GDP figures[2].

However,

Strengths:

– Provides timely signals about systemic risks– Enhances tactical asset allocation decisions– Helps identify undervalued debt securities during turbulent times

Limitations:

– Can be misleading if used without considering macroeconomic context– Sensitive to liquidity shocks affecting bond markets disproportionately– Not always predictive during unprecedented events like pandemics

Compared with passive buy-and-hold equity approaches—which rely heavily on long-term fundamentals—credit-spread trading demands active management skills but offers potentially higher short-term gains if executed correctly.

Integrating Multiple Approaches for Better Portfolio Management

The most effective investment portfolios typically combine multiple strategies tailored accordingto individual goalsandrisk tolerance.[3] Incorporating insights fromcreditspread analysis alongside equity valuation modelsand diversifications techniques creates a balanced approach capableof navigating varyingmarket environments effectively.[4]

For example,

  1. Usecreditspread trendsas partof your macroeconomic outlook assessment,
  2. Combine thiswith fundamental analysisof individual stocks,
  3. Maintain diversified holdingsacross asset classes including equities,reits,and commodities,
  4. Adjust allocations dynamically basedon evolving signalsfrom all sources,

This integrated approach leverages each strategy's strengths while mitigating weaknesses inherentin any single method.

Final Thoughts: Choosing Between Different Investment Approaches

When evaluating whether tousecredit-spread-basedstrategies versus others,it’s importantto consider yourinvestment horizon,timeframe,andrisk appetite.[5] Fixed-income tactics centered around monitoringcreditspreds excel at capturing short-to-medium-term shiftsin market sentimentanddefault expectations,but may underperformduring prolonged bull runsor whenmacro indicators diverge frombond-market signals.[6]

Meanwhile,equity-focusedinvestmentsoffergrowthpotentialbutcomewithhighervolatilityand longer recovery periodsafter downturns.[7] Diversification remains key—blending multiple methods ensures resilienceagainst unpredictablemarket shockswhile aligningwith personalfinancial goals.[8]

By understanding how each approach compares—and recognizingthe unique advantagesofferedbycredit-spread analysis—youcan crafta well-informedstrategy suitedtothe currentmarket landscape.

When to Use Credit Spreads in Investment and Risk Management

Understanding credit spreads is essential for investors, financial analysts, and portfolio managers aiming to assess credit risk, optimize investment strategies, or hedge against market volatility. These spreads serve as a vital indicator of market sentiment and economic outlooks, guiding decision-making across various scenarios.

Assessing Credit Risk in Bond Investments

One of the primary uses of credit spreads is evaluating the relative risk associated with different bonds. When considering high-yield (junk) bonds versus safer government securities like U.S. Treasuries, the spread quantifies how much extra return an investor demands for taking on additional risk. A widening spread indicates increased perceived risk—perhaps due to deteriorating issuer fundamentals or broader economic concerns—prompting investors to reconsider their holdings or adjust their portfolios accordingly.

Conversely, narrowing credit spreads suggest improving confidence in corporate borrowers' ability to meet debt obligations. Investors can leverage this information when selecting bonds that align with their risk appetite or when reallocating assets during changing market conditions.

Timing Market Entry and Exit Points

Credit spreads are valuable tools for timing investment decisions. For instance:

  • Entry Point: Narrowing spreads may signal a period of economic recovery or stability, making it an opportune moment to increase exposure to higher-yield assets before risks re-emerge.
  • Exit Point: Conversely, widening spreads often precede downturns or heightened uncertainty; recognizing this trend allows investors to reduce exposure in risky asset classes proactively.

Monitoring these shifts helps manage downside risks while capitalizing on favorable market phases.

Evaluating Economic Conditions and Business Cycles

Credit spread movements often reflect underlying macroeconomic trends. During periods of economic expansion, credit spreads tend to narrow as companies demonstrate stronger financial health and default risks diminish. In contrast, during recessions or times of financial stress—such as geopolitical tensions or policy uncertainties—spreads typically widen due to increased default fears.

Investors use these signals not only for individual bond selection but also as early warning indicators of potential economic downturns. For example:

  • Persistent widening could foreshadow recessionary pressures.
  • Sudden narrowing might indicate overly optimistic sentiment that could lead to inflated asset prices.

By integrating credit spread analysis into macroeconomic assessments, stakeholders can better anticipate shifts in the business cycle.

Managing Portfolio Risks During Market Volatility

Market volatility influences credit spreads significantly; periods marked by turbulence often see wider spreads across high-yield sectors while investment-grade bonds remain relatively stable initially. Recognizing these patterns enables portfolio managers to implement hedging strategies effectively—for example:

  • Increasing allocations toward safer assets like government bonds during uncertain times.
  • Using derivatives such as options on bond ETFs that track changes in credit premiums.

This proactive approach helps mitigate losses from sudden market swings driven by geopolitical events, monetary policy changes, or fiscal uncertainties.

Making Informed Decisions with Regulatory Changes

Policy developments related to fiscal policies and trade agreements can impact investor confidence and thus influence credit spreads substantially. For instance:

  • Announcements of new tariffs may cause immediate widening due to anticipated supply chain disruptions.
  • Fiscal stimulus measures might temporarily narrow spreads if they bolster corporate earnings prospects.

Investors monitoring regulatory environments should incorporate real-time changes into their analysis framework using credit spread data—a practice that enhances decision-making accuracy amid evolving policy landscapes.

Practical Scenarios Where Credit Spreads Are Most Useful

Here are some specific situations where analyzing credit spreads provides tangible benefits:

  1. Risk Assessment Before Bond Purchases: Before investing in high-yield bonds during periods of uncertainty—or when markets are volatile—review current spread levels relative to historical averages ensures informed choices aligned with your risk tolerance.

  2. Portfolio Rebalancing: During times when broad markets experience fluctuations (e.g., rising interest rates), tracking how different segments' credits behave helps decide whether shifting toward safer assets is prudent.

  3. Monitoring Economic Indicators: Regularly observing shifts in overall market-wide credit premiums offers insights into potential upcoming recessions or recoveries—not just at an individual security level but across entire sectors.

  4. Hedging Strategies: If you hold a significant position exposed directly through corporate bonds or ETFs sensitive to changing credits (like CLO funds), understanding current trends allows you timely adjustments via derivatives contracts designed around expected movements in yields.

Final Thoughts on Using Credit Spreads Effectively

Incorporating the analysis of credit spreads into your investment toolkit enhances both strategic planning and tactical responses within dynamic markets. Whether assessing individual securities’ risks during turbulent times—or gauging broader macroeconomic signals—they provide crucial insights grounded in real-time data reflecting investor sentiment about future defaults and economic health.

By staying attentive not only at specific points but also over longer-term cycles—watching how these premiums evolve—you position yourself better for navigating complex financial landscapes while managing downside risks effectively.


Note: Always consider combining multiple indicators—including macroeconomic data—and consult with financial professionals before making significant investment decisions based solely on changes in credit spreds for comprehensive risk management tailored specifically for your goals.*

How the Crypto Fear & Greed Index Helps Traders Make Better Decisions

Understanding market sentiment is crucial for successful trading, especially in the highly volatile world of cryptocurrencies. The Crypto Fear & Greed Index offers traders a valuable tool to gauge investor emotions and anticipate potential market movements. By analyzing this index, traders can enhance their decision-making process, manage risks more effectively, and identify optimal entry and exit points.

What Is the Crypto Fear & Greed Index?

The Crypto Fear & Greed Index is an algorithmic indicator designed to measure the overall sentiment of cryptocurrency investors. Created by Alternative.me in 2018, it synthesizes various data points—such as price volatility, trading volume, social media activity (like Twitter sentiment), and market capitalization—to produce a single score reflecting current market emotions. This score ranges from 0 to 100: lower values indicate fear or panic selling among investors; higher values suggest greed or overconfidence.

This index mirrors similar tools used in traditional financial markets but tailored specifically for cryptocurrencies' unique dynamics. Its primary purpose is to provide traders with a quick snapshot of whether the market is overly fearful or excessively greedy—conditions that often precede significant price reversals.

How Does the Index Work?

The index operates on a scale from 0 to 100:

  • 0-24: Extreme Fear – Investors are panicking; prices may be undervalued.
  • 25-49: Fear – Caution prevails; some selling pressure exists.
  • 50: Neutral – Market shows balanced sentiment.
  • 51-74: Greed – Optimism increases; prices might be overbought.
  • 75-100: Extreme Greed – Overconfidence dominates; risk of correction rises.

Traders interpret these signals differently depending on their strategies. For example, extreme fear levels might signal buying opportunities due to potential undervaluation, while extreme greed could warn against entering new long positions or suggest taking profits.

Why Is Sentiment Analysis Important in Cryptocurrency Trading?

Cryptocurrency markets are known for their high volatility driven not only by technical factors but also by emotional reactions among investors. FOMO (Fear Of Missing Out), panic selling during downturns, and exuberance during rallies can all lead to irrational decision-making that deviates from fundamental analysis.

Sentiment analysis tools like the Crypto Fear & Greed Index help traders cut through emotional noise by providing objective data about prevailing investor moods. Recognizing when markets are overly fearful can present contrarian buying opportunities—buy low scenarios—while identifying excessive greed may prompt caution or profit-taking before a correction occurs.

Practical Ways Traders Use the Index

Traders incorporate the Crypto Fear & Greed Index into their strategies through various approaches:

  1. Contrarian Investing: Buying when fear levels are high (index below 25) with expectations of rebound.
  2. Profit Taking: Selling or reducing exposure when greed levels reach extremes (above 75).
  3. Market Timing: Combining index signals with technical analysis for more precise entries/exits.
  4. Risk Management: Adjusting position sizes based on current sentiment—smaller trades during uncertain times and larger ones when confidence is high.

Additionally, many traders use historical patterns observed via this index as part of broader trend analysis models aimed at predicting future movements based on past behavior under similar sentiment conditions.

Limitations and Risks

While valuable, reliance solely on the Crypto Fear & Greed Index has its pitfalls:

  • It provides a snapshot rather than comprehensive insight into fundamentals such as project development progress or macroeconomic factors influencing crypto prices.

  • Market sentiments can remain irrational longer than expected—a phenomenon known as "market timing risk."

  • Overreacting to short-term swings in sentiment may lead traders astray if they ignore underlying asset fundamentals or broader economic indicators.

Therefore, it's essential for traders to combine this tool with other forms of analysis—including technical charts, news events tracking, macroeconomic data—and maintain disciplined risk management practices.

Recent Trends Enhancing Its Effectiveness

In recent years, technological advancements have improved how accurately this index reflects real-time market psychology:

  • The integration of machine learning algorithms allows for better pattern recognition across diverse data sources such as social media trends and trading volumes.

  • Updates introduced by Alternative.me have expanded data inputs beyond basic metrics—for example incorporating network activity metrics—to refine sentiment assessment further.

These improvements make it easier for traders to interpret current conditions more reliably than ever before while adapting quickly during rapid shifts like those seen during major events such as exchange collapses or regulatory crackdowns.

Furthermore, increased community engagement around behavioral finance concepts has led many retail investors and institutional players alike to pay closer attention not just individually but collectively—as reflected through indices like these—in shaping overall market dynamics.


By understanding how investor emotions influence cryptocurrency prices—and leveraging tools like the Crypto Fear & Greed Index—traders gain an edge in navigating unpredictable markets. While no single indicator guarantees success alone—the key lies in combining multiple analytical methods—they serve as vital components within a comprehensive trading strategy rooted in informed decision-making rather than impulsive reactions driven purely by emotion.

The Impact of Bitcoin's Legality on Its Price Volatility

Understanding how the legal status of Bitcoin influences its price fluctuations is essential for investors, regulators, and market observers alike. As the most prominent cryptocurrency, Bitcoin’s value is highly sensitive to regulatory developments across different jurisdictions. This article explores how legality shapes Bitcoin’s market behavior, highlighting recent trends and potential future implications.

Legal Frameworks and Their Effect on Market Stability

Bitcoin's legal environment varies widely around the world. Countries with clear and supportive regulations—such as Japan, South Korea, and Singapore—have fostered a more stable trading environment. These nations have established comprehensive guidelines that legitimize cryptocurrency activities, encouraging adoption among consumers and businesses. When regulations are transparent and consistent, investor confidence tends to increase because participants feel protected against fraud or sudden policy shifts.

Conversely, regions with strict or ambiguous rules tend to experience heightened volatility. For example, China’s crackdown on cryptocurrencies—including banning ICOs (Initial Coin Offerings) in 2017—caused significant price drops both domestically and globally. Such regulatory crackdowns create uncertainty among traders who may rush to sell holdings fearing future restrictions or outright bans.

In countries where cryptocurrencies are banned altogether—like Bolivia or Ecuador—their use diminishes sharply within those borders but can still influence global markets through reduced liquidity pools. Less liquidity often leads to sharper price swings when large trades occur or when new regulatory announcements are made.

Regulatory Uncertainty: A Catalyst for Price Fluctuations

Uncertainty surrounding cryptocurrency regulation remains one of the primary drivers of Bitcoin’s price volatility. When governments announce potential restrictions or tighten existing rules without clear timelines or details, markets react swiftly with sharp declines in value as traders seek safety elsewhere.

For instance:

  • The anticipation of a ban can lead to panic selling.
  • Conversely, positive signals about regulation can boost prices by attracting institutional investors seeking clarity.

This pattern underscores why stable regulatory environments tend to correlate with less volatile prices—they reduce unpredictability by providing clear guidelines that market participants can trust.

Recent Regulatory Developments Shaping Market Dynamics

Over recent years, major economies have taken steps toward establishing clearer frameworks for cryptocurrencies:

  • United States: In 2023, the US Securities and Exchange Commission (SEC) issued more defined guidelines regarding token classification—a move aimed at reducing ambiguity for crypto projects listed on US exchanges.

  • European Union: The EU has proposed comprehensive legislation designed to harmonize crypto regulations across member states by 2024. This initiative aims not only at consumer protection but also at fostering innovation while maintaining financial stability.

These developments suggest a trend toward greater regulatory clarity worldwide—a factor likely contributing over time to reduced volatility as markets adapt accordingly.

Potential Long-Term Effects of Regulatory Changes

The evolving legal landscape influences several key aspects of Bitcoin trading:

  1. Investor Confidence: Stable laws attract institutional players who require certainty before allocating funds into digital assets.
  2. Market Liquidity: Clearer regulations encourage broader participation from retail investors; conversely, bans limit liquidity pools leading to increased price swings.
  3. Technological Progress: Advances like decentralized finance (DeFi) solutions aim at creating more transparent transaction mechanisms that could mitigate some effects caused by regulatory uncertainties.

While regulation alone cannot eliminate all volatility inherent in emerging asset classes like cryptocurrencies—which are still relatively young—it plays a crucial role in shaping long-term stability prospects.

Historical Context Shows Regulation's Role in Price Trends

Looking back:

  • In 2017**, China’s ban on ICOs triggered a steep decline across global crypto markets.
  • By 2020**, clearer guidance from US authorities helped stabilize some parts of the industry amid ongoing debates about token classifications.
  • Recent proposals from Europe aim at standardizing rules across multiple jurisdictions—a move expected eventually to smooth out abrupt market reactions caused by inconsistent policies elsewhere.

Such historical examples reinforce how legislative actions directly impact investor sentiment—and consequently—the pricing behavior of Bitcoin over time.

Implications for Investors and Market Participants

For those involved in cryptocurrency trading or investment:

  • Monitoring legal developments should be part of risk management strategies since sudden policy shifts can cause rapid price changes.
  • Favoring jurisdictions with transparent regulations might reduce exposure to unexpected volatility spikes.

Additionally,

  • Understanding regional differences* helps assess where opportunities may arise versus areas prone to sudden downturns due solely to legal uncertainties.

How Future Regulations Could Shape Cryptocurrency Markets

As governments continue refining their approaches towards digital assets:

  • We might see increased adoption driven by clearer rules that protect consumers while enabling innovation
  • Conversely*, overly restrictive policies could suppress growth opportunities,* leading traders into less regulated offshore markets which carry their own risks

Overall*, balanced regulation appears key—not only for reducing short-term volatility but also for fostering sustainable growth within the cryptocurrency ecosystem.*

By recognizing these dynamics between legality and market behavior*, stakeholders can better navigate an increasingly complex landscape.* Whether you’re an investor seeking stability or a regulator aiming for responsible innovation*, understanding this relationship is vital.*

How Does Dogecoin Work?

Understanding how Dogecoin functions requires a look into its underlying technology, consensus mechanisms, and community-driven features. Despite its origins as a joke, Dogecoin has established itself as a legitimate cryptocurrency with unique characteristics that influence its operation and adoption.

Blockchain Technology and Proof-of-Work Consensus

Dogecoin operates on a blockchain—a decentralized digital ledger that records all transactions transparently. Like Bitcoin, it uses a proof-of-work (PoW) consensus algorithm to validate transactions and add new blocks to the chain. This process involves miners solving complex mathematical problems using computational power. Once these problems are solved, the transaction data is confirmed and added to the blockchain.

The PoW mechanism ensures security by making it computationally expensive for malicious actors to alter transaction history or manipulate the network. Miners compete to solve cryptographic puzzles; the first one to succeed earns rewards in the form of newly minted Dogecoins and transaction fees from users.

Mining Process and Block Rewards

Mining in Dogecoin follows similar principles as Bitcoin but with some differences tailored for efficiency and community engagement. Miners validate transactions by solving cryptographic challenges; upon success, they create new blocks containing recent transactions.

Dogecoin's block time—how quickly new blocks are added—is approximately one minute, which is faster than Bitcoin’s 10-minute interval. This quicker pace allows for faster confirmation of transactions but also requires robust network security measures due to increased block generation frequency.

Initially, miners received fixed rewards per block; however, over time, these rewards have been adjusted through protocol upgrades aimed at maintaining network stability while controlling inflation within the capped supply of 100 billion coins.

Supply Mechanics: Capped vs. Inflationary Model

Unlike Bitcoin’s fixed supply cap of 21 million coins, Dogecoin has an intentionally high total supply limit set at 100 billion coins—though this cap is not strictly enforced like Bitcoin’s halving schedule. Instead, Dogecoin employs an inflationary model where new coins are continuously mined without diminishing rewards indefinitely.

This approach encourages ongoing participation from miners by providing consistent incentives while keeping transaction fees relatively low compared to other cryptocurrencies with limited supplies that often experience scarcity-driven price increases.

Transaction Validation & Pseudonymity

When users send or receive Dogecoin, their transactions are recorded on the blockchain—a transparent ledger accessible publicly but linked only via pseudonymous addresses rather than personal identities. This pseudonymity offers privacy benefits while maintaining transparency essential for trustless verification processes inherent in decentralized networks.

Transactions typically involve transferring tokens between wallet addresses without requiring intermediaries like banks or payment processors—making peer-to-peer transfers fast and cost-effective globally.

Community Role in Network Security & Development

While technically secure through cryptography and decentralization principles, community involvement plays an essential role in sustaining Dogecoin's ecosystem. The active user base participates not only through mining but also via charitable initiatives such as fundraising campaigns for disaster relief or supporting sports teams like Jamaica’s Bobsled Team.

Community-led projects like The Dogecoin Foundation aim to promote development efforts—including software upgrades—and foster broader adoption across various platforms including online gaming sites or payment processors integrated into e-commerce systems.

How Is Dogecoin Used?

Dogecoin's functionality extends beyond mere speculation; it serves practical purposes driven largely by its vibrant community support:

  • Tipping: Many content creators use dogecoins as tips on social media platforms such as Reddit or Twitter.
  • Charitable Donations: The community frequently organizes fundraising campaigns leveraging their collective holdings.
  • Online Payments: Some merchants accept dogecoins directly due to ease of transferability.
  • Fundraising Campaigns: Notable initiatives include raising funds for clean water projects or disaster relief efforts worldwide.

Its ease of use combined with low transaction costs makes it appealing for microtransactions—small payments often unfeasible with traditional banking systems—and supports grassroots financial inclusion efforts globally.

Security Considerations & Risks Associated With Using Dogecoin

Despite its strengths rooted in decentralization and cryptography-based security measures—including encryption protocols protecting user data—Dogecoin faces certain risks:

  • Market Volatility: Price swings driven by market sentiment can lead investors into significant gains or losses within short periods.
  • Regulatory Changes: As governments scrutinize cryptocurrencies more closely worldwide, regulatory policies could impact usage legality or tax obligations.
  • Security Threats:
    • Hacking: Wallet breaches remain possible if users do not implement strong security practices.
    • 51% Attacks: Although less common due to large network size compared to smaller altcoins,malicious actors gaining majority control could potentially manipulate transaction validation processes.

To mitigate these risks:

  • Users should store funds securely using reputable wallets,
  • Regularly update software,
  • Stay informed about evolving regulations,
  • Participate actively within trusted communities.

Future Outlook for How Dogs Work Within Cryptocurrency Ecosystems

As one of the most recognizable meme-inspired cryptocurrencies with active development efforts underway—including protocol upgrades aimed at scalability—the future prospects look promising yet uncertain given market volatility factors involved in crypto investments overall.

Technological advancements such as integration into mainstream payment systems increase utility potential; meanwhile ongoing community engagement sustains interest despite fluctuations influenced by broader economic trends like institutional adoption waves seen during recent bull markets (e.g., 2021).

In summary,

Dogecoin exemplifies how decentralized technology combined with passionate communities can transform what started as internet humor into a functional digital asset used worldwide—from tipping content creators online—to supporting charitable causes—all underpinned by robust blockchain mechanics ensuring transparency and security amidst evolving regulatory landscapes.

How Are NFTs Fundamentally Different from Cryptocurrencies Like Bitcoin (BTC)?

Understanding the distinctions between Non-Fungible Tokens (NFTs) and cryptocurrencies such as Bitcoin is essential for anyone interested in digital assets. While both operate on blockchain technology, their purposes, characteristics, and market behaviors differ significantly. This article explores these differences to provide clarity for investors, collectors, and enthusiasts navigating the evolving digital landscape.

What Are NFTs? Defining Unique Digital Assets

NFTs are a type of digital asset that represent ownership of a specific item or piece of content. Unlike traditional cryptocurrencies that are interchangeable, NFTs are non-fungible—meaning each token is unique and cannot be exchanged on a one-to-one basis with another NFT. They often serve as proof of ownership for digital art, collectibles like CryptoPunks or Bored Ape Yacht Club characters, music files, videos, virtual real estate within metaverse platforms, or even event tickets.

The core value proposition of NFTs lies in their ability to authenticate originality and provenance through blockchain technology. Each NFT contains metadata that distinguishes it from others—such as a serial number or specific attributes—making it identifiable and verifiable on platforms like OpenSea or Rarible. This uniqueness has driven explosive growth in markets centered around art collection and digital memorabilia.

Ownership rights associated with NFTs are recorded immutably on the blockchain; this transparency ensures buyers can verify authenticity without relying on third-party intermediaries. As an asset class, NFTs have attracted attention not only from individual collectors but also from brands seeking new ways to engage audiences through limited-edition releases or exclusive experiences.

Cryptocurrencies: The Digital Money

Cryptocurrencies like Bitcoin (BTC) function primarily as decentralized digital currencies designed for secure financial transactions without intermediaries such as banks or governments. They are fungible assets—each unit holds equal value—and can be exchanged seamlessly with other units of the same currency.

Bitcoin was introduced in 2009 by an anonymous entity known as Satoshi Nakamoto with the goal of creating a peer-to-peer electronic cash system. Since then, thousands of other cryptocurrencies have emerged offering various features—from privacy-focused coins like Monero to smart contract platforms such as Ethereum.

The key characteristic that defines cryptocurrencies is their fungibility; one Bitcoin has exactly the same value as another Bitcoin at any given moment. Transactions involving cryptocurrencies are recorded publicly on blockchains—a distributed ledger ensuring transparency while maintaining user pseudonymity—and secured through cryptographic algorithms.

Mining remains central to many cryptocurrency networks; miners validate transactions and create new units based on consensus mechanisms like Proof-of-Work (PoW). The cryptocurrency market is known for its high volatility driven by factors including regulatory developments, technological advancements, macroeconomic trends, and speculative trading behavior.

Core Differences Between NFTs and Cryptocurrencies

While both rely heavily on blockchain technology for security and transparency—they serve different functions within the digital economy:

  • Fungibility vs Non-Fungibility:
    Cryptocurrencies such as BTC are fungible; each token holds identical value regardless of origin or history. In contrast,NFTs possess unique identifiers making each one distinct with individual worth based on rarity,provenance,creator reputation,or collector demand.

  • Purpose & Use Cases:
    Cryptocurrencies primarily facilitate financial transactions,store value,act as investment assets, or serve as mediums for remittances across borders.

    Conversely, NFTs function mainly in ownership verification — serving sectors like art collection, gaming (in-game items), entertainment licensing,and virtual real estate.

  • Market Dynamics & Liquidity:
    Cryptocurrency markets tend to be highly liquid due to widespread adoptionand large trading volumes.NFT markets can be less liquid because sales depend heavily on buyer interestand perceived rarity;liquidity varies significantly across different collectionsand platforms.

  • Ownership & Rights:
    Owning cryptocurrency means holding a stake in an entire network's monetary system;it grants access to transfer funds securely.Owning an NFT signifies proof-of-authentication over a specific item but does not necessarily confer copyright ownership unless explicitly stated by licensing terms.

Recent Trends Shaping These Markets

Both sectors have experienced rapid growth recently but face distinct challenges:

Growth Drivers & Market Expansion

NFT sales surged notably during early phases around 2021 when collections like CryptoPunks gained mainstream attention alongside celebrity endorsements which drove prices sky-high. By mid-2023–2025,

the market continued evolving with innovations such as fractionalized ownership models allowing multiple investors access to high-value tokens,

new use cases emerging beyond art—including virtual fashion items,

music royalties,

and branded experiences linked directly via blockchain protocols.

Meanwhile,

cryptocurrency markets saw increased institutional interest despite regulatory uncertainties;

notable developments include major exchanges expanding offerings,

regulatory bodies scrutinizing classifications,

but overall market capitalization remained robust amid macroeconomic shifts affecting investor sentiment globally[1][2][3].

Regulatory Environment Impact

Regulatory clarity remains crucial: recent actions suggest regulators aim at establishing clearer frameworks rather than outright bans—for example,

the SEC’s dismissal of lawsuits against firms like Coinbase indicates potential openness towards integrating these assets into regulated financial systems[2].

This evolving landscape influences investor confidence while prompting industry players to adapt compliance strategies accordingly[4].

Risks & Challenges Ahead

Despite promising growth trajectories,

both NFT creators/investors and cryptocurrency holders face risks:

  • Market Volatility: Price swings can lead to significant gains—or losses—in short periods.
  • Regulatory Uncertainty: Lack of comprehensive rules may impact future operationsor lead to legal complications.
  • Security Concerns: Hacks targeting wallets/exchanges pose threats;proper security measures remain essential.
  • Intellectual Property Issues: Ownership does not always equate to copyright transfer;clarity around rights remains necessary especially within NFT marketplaces[4].

Understanding these risks helps users make informed decisions aligned with their risk appetite while contributing positively toward sustainable development within this space.

Final Thoughts: Navigating Digital Assets Effectively

Fundamentally differentiating between NFTs and cryptocurrencies involves recognizing their core functions: one verifies ownership over unique items; the other facilitates decentralized monetary exchange. Both leverage blockchain’s transparency but cater distinctly either toward collecting rare items or enabling seamless financial transactions globally.

As regulatory landscapes evolve alongside technological innovations—such as integration into mainstream finance—the importance lies in staying informed about legal frameworks’ direction while assessing personal goals related specifically either toward investment opportunities or creative endeavors involving these dynamic assets [1][2][3][4].

By understanding these fundamental differences thoroughly—with attention paid both historically and emerging trends—you position yourself better whether you’re investing strategically—or simply exploring how blockchain continues transforming our economic ecosystem.
